The laser alignment system of the ZEUS microvertex detector is described. The detector was installed in 2001 as part of an upgrade programme in preparation for the second phase of electron-proton physics at the HERA collider. The alignment system monitors the position of the vertex detector support structure with respect to the central tracking detector using semi-transparent amorphous-silicon sensors and diode lasers. The system is fully integrated into the general environmental monitoring of the ZEUS detector and data has been collected over a period of 5 years. The primary aim of defining periods of stability for track-based alignment has been achieved and the system is able to measure movements of the support structure to a precision around 10μm.

Heavy quarks at HERA with lifetime tag

Two preliminary measurements of beauty production in events with two jets at HERA are presented. The first exploits the new ZEUS microvertex detector to measure the b content of a sample of events with two jets and a muon. The OPAL Silicon Strip Microvertex Detector with Two Coordinate Readout

The OPAL experiment at the CERN LEP collider recently upgraded its silicon strip microvertex detector from one coordinate readout ( only) to two coordinate readout ( and z). This allows three dimensional vertex reconstruction and should improve lifetime measurements as well as b quark jet identi cation. Cluster Repairing in the Microvertex Detector

The cluster xing algorithms are described for the DELPHI microvertex detector. For the few percent of aaected clusters a considerable improvement in precision and in the description of their resolution function has been obtained.
